Success Story : Lucky Maduwa

One of our staff members at the Phuthaditjaba Centre in Alexandra was awarded with a bursary to study Sales and Marketing at Varsity College in Sandton.

Lucky has been working in the sporting department but also managed to find time to do journalism for the centre and head office in Hyde Park. As part of his journalism work he wanted to market Phuthaditjaba Centre to the people all over the world, he created a Facebook page, which has 327 likes, and a twitter page, with 87 followers. Lucky has covered a lot of events under Afrika Tikkun, produced documentaries and he also writes articles that are published on supernews website and the Afrika Tikkun Newsletter.

Lucky Maduwa got his bursary through Amanda Blankfield and Nancy Chimhandamba who have been monitoring his work and development. The Marketing Management programme is valued at R13 000.00 for tuition. Lucky started with his classes on Saturday the 2nd of March. He has worked his way up and has proven himself to the organisation, gaining valuable experience that has aided him in his study efforts at Varsity College.
